Simplify Your Writing Environment with JDarkRoom

JDarkRoom is a cool little (100k) program that let's you see nothing but the words your typing (i.e., eliminate distractions.)
I don't like that I can't italicize (because I think it is really intended for people writing code, not prose,) but otherwise it's quite nice.

P.S. If it doesn't work, it's probably b/c you don't have the latest Java update.

Thoughts on Losing Family from Life of Pi

Thoughts on loss from Yann Martel's Life of Pi:
"...to lose your brother is to lose someone with whom you can share the experience of growing old, who is supposed to bring you sister-in-law and nieces and nephews, creatures to people the tree of your life and give it new branches. To lose your father is like to lose the one whose guidance and help you seek, who supports you like a tree trunk supports its branches. To lose your mother, well, that's like losing the sun above you..."
